Seeking a skilled Ultrasound Technologist specializing in general imaging to provide exceptional diagnostic services in Monument, CO. This contract opportunity allows you to advance your career in a dynamic healthcare environment supporting patient care through high-quality ultrasound imaging.
Responsibilities:
- Perform general ultrasound imaging procedures with accuracy and efficiency.
- Prepare patients and equipment for diagnostic exams.
- Collaborate with physicians to ensure precise imaging results.
- Maintain imaging equipment and ensure compliance with safety protocols.
- Document and report findings thoroughly and timely.
Qualifications:
- Certification or degree in Diagnostic Medical Sonography or relevant field.
- Proficient in general ultrasound imaging techniques.
- Strong attention to detail and patient care skills.
- Ability to operate ultrasound equipment safely and effectively.
- Excellent communication and teamwork abilities.
